Planning a dream trip but feeling overwhelmed by flights, hotels and travel budgets?

This episode of Everything Counts is your essential guide to smart travel planning. It covers how to get the best value, avoid common pitfalls, and create authentic experiences without breaking the bank.

702’s Motheo Khoaripe is joined by Paolo Giuricich (Head of Investec Travel) and Liezl Gericke (Head of International - Africa, Middle East, and Asia Pacific) at Virgin Atlantic to share how industry insiders get more value when they travel: from when to book flights, how loyalty programmes can boost your journey, to using technology and trusted advisors to maximise every rand spent.

Whether you’re a first-time traveller or a seasoned explorer, this conversation will help you plan smarter, travel better and make every trip truly count.
